rockFord_Expedition Posted November 4, 2013 Report Posted November 4, 2013 Depends on the abuse level. ^---- this Depends on the hours of use and the demand placed on it. That's one of those parts that miles, and time don't mean much. That being said, I am not sure if there is any real testing that has been done to establish any type of standard. Many times, people think high output and high quality are synonymous, They are not. I personally went with DC Power in hopes to get both.
